My brother was diagnosed with astrocytoma in his left frontal lobe, at age 28, after experiencing the epileptic seizures. The tumor vas an orange size and urgent brain surgery was successfully performed in Croatia. After surgery they did radiation. 30 years later the tumor returned and 2 nd surgery was done in Sweden. The surgery went well, but this time a lot damage was caused by removing tumor.
